Canada - Re-Export of Transformers Electric Having a Power Handling Capacity of 1-16 kVA
Since 2014, Canada Re-Export of Transformers Electric Having a Power Handling Capacity of 1-16 kVA was down by 1.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 2 among other countries in Re-Export of Transformers Electric Having a Power Handling Capacity of 1-16 kVA at $3,712,305.5. United States ranked the highest with $20,028,759.31 in 2019, a growth of 1.9% versus 2018. Thailand recorded the best 5 years average growth at +118% per year, while United Kingdom witnessed the worst performance at -57.8% per year.
